Texas has two of the most extreme weather condition problems a roof system can face: high winds and hail.


No. Guarantees lay out the manufacturer's obligation and obligation over a collection period of years. Since the majority of guarantees are prorated, the manufacturer's obligation remains to decrease as the months go by. Evaluate the outdoor decking when the roof covering is eliminated and replace damaged decking. For optimum wind and windborne particles resistance on brand-new setups or where current conditions would certainly allow, using thicker outdoor decking, use 5/8" thick plywood - roofing companies st louis mo.

Ensure the nails permeate the decking directly into the roofing framing. Look in the attic room. If you can see nails alongside the rafters or trusses, where the nail permeates the outdoor decking, your roof covering deck might not be securely secured. Yes. Set up self-adhering flashing tape or polymer bitumen strips (generally called peel-and-seal) on top of the joints in your roofing deck.




Flashings are connections to the roof covering to any type of projection in the roof system or any kind of wall surface that the roofing system butts approximately. These are crucial locations that will certainly allow rainfall to penetrate if they are not set up and secured effectively. If you are in a high wind location, roof-to-wall links are suggested.


Supporting may be beyond your professional roofer's extent and she or he might have to deal with a structure specialist. The bottom decking will have to be eliminated, bracing set up, and after that the outdoor decking replaced. Collapse of a gable end wall is an usual failure during hurricanes. To suit the solid pressures of hurricane force winds, gable ends need added bracing.

Working with a roof contractor is not something that can be carried out in a number of hours. See to it that your service provider has employee's settlement and liability insurance coverage. Worker's payment will offer coverage if a professional is wounded at work, and general obligation insurance policy safeguards your home if a service provider damages it while finishing job.

Validate that the roof contractor or business is reputable by asking for their tax obligation identification number, a service address, service website or email address, and contact contact number. In some locations, there is no need for professional roofer to have licenses. Also if that holds true in your location, I still advise selecting a contractor who has one anyway.


Plus a start and end date and details concerning removing the old roof covering and a knockout post evaluation of the existing roofing system, repair service or replacement. The contract needs to also consist of details on how the yards and landscaping will certainly be secured, that is liable for the clean-up, and any kind of damages to building or your neighbor's that might take place during the job.

Autumn arrest security is needed by law for any height 10 feet in the air and employers need to give all employees with OSHA approved equipment. Since April 2017, all roofer need to have a functioning at elevations training card, which verifies they have actually been educated to function securely at elevations.




If you believe you have an excellent service provider lined up, ask them for references from previous customers. Call those referrals and if you can, go and see the job they have carried out and finished!
